As ageing is associated with several changes in each systems of the body which also includes alterations in the sensory systems that is the somatosensory, visual and vestibular systems. One of the major component of the vestibular system is the vestibular ocular reflex (VOR) which has been also shown to decline with ageing but to the best of my knowledge, its effectiveness and impact on elderly in postural control is still limited. How an individual will integrate or compensate when one or more of these are challenged including VOR is yet not evident. Clinically, the importance of sensory strategy incorporating VOR is not established yet.
All the subjects will be informed about the nature, purpose, and possible risks involved in the study and an informed written consent will be taken from them prior to participation. All the subjects will be selected based on the inclusion criteria. Subjects will be familiarized for the activity. After recruitment , the subjects have to perform six sensory conditions: standing with Eyes Open and Eyes Closed on a Firm and Foam surface respectively and two additional conditions of VOR which involves the subject to keep the eyes fixed on a target in front and simultaneously rotating the head horiziontally on firm and foam surface respectively. During the performance the subject will be tested for Muscle activation patterns, Centre of pressure sway. Lastly, postural analysis will be done to know the angular deviations. Overall, the study will give an idea of the role of VOR on postural control in elderly.
